It’s just a no-name two component filler from an autoparts store. Get a cheap one that says “light”, “fine”, “sands easy” or something similar.

Disclaimer.
Read the instructions and health hazard advice on any chemical product you use.

Any recommended print settings?

1 Like

I printed the arc and lock parts on their sides and increased the fill to 25% and increased the wall thickness a bit.
